== Morrish Bible Dictionary <ref name="term_67293" /> ==
== Morrish Bible Dictionary <ref name="term_67293" /> ==
<p> 1. City in the far north of Palestine, conquered by the tribe of Dan. Judges 18:7,14,27; Isaiah 10:30 . Called LESHEM in Joshua 19:47 . Its name was afterwards altered to DAN, <i> q.v. </i> </p> <p> 2. Father of Phalti, or Phaltiel. 1 Samuel 25:44; 2 Samuel 3:15 . </p>

== International Standard Bible Encyclopedia <ref name="term_5782" /> ==
== International Standard Bible Encyclopedia <ref name="term_5782" /> ==
<p> ''''' lā´ish ''''' ( לישׁ , <i> ''''' layish ''''' </i> ): </p> <p> (1) A city in the upper [[Jordan]] valley, apparently colonized by the Sidonians, which was captured by the Danires and called [[Dan]] (which see) (Judges 18:7 , etc.; Isaiah 10:30 the King James Version). In Joshua 19:47 the name appears as "Leshem." </p> <p> (2) A B enjamite, father of Palti or Paltiel, to whom Michal, David's wife, was given by Saul (1 Samuel 25:44; 2 Samuel 3:15 ). </p>
